Growth Habit Indica

Indica-type growth habits are characterized by compact plant structure, shorter internodal spacing, and lateral branching patterns that develop early in the vegetative cycle. Plants in this family typically reach 60–100 cm in height, with broad leaves and sturdy stems adapted to shorter flowering periods. Lineage records frequently report these traits concentrating in landraces from the Hindu Kush, Afghanistan, and Central Asian regions, where environmental pressures favored stocky, cold-resilient architecture. Modern breeders often select for indica growth patterns when seeking plants suited to space-constrained indoor cultivation or when crossbreeding for structural stability in hybrid lines.

Breeder relevance

Breeders working with indica growth habits prioritize these traits for yield density, canopy management, and resilience to environmental stress. The compact structure makes this family valuable for developing cultivars adapted to controlled environments and for creating hybrid vigor in crosses with sativa-leaning lines.
